Marble Floor Types

From the sun-kissed quarries of Carrara to the ancient mines of Calacatta, marble flooring has graced the world’s most magnificent spaces for millennia. Today’s marble floors offer an astounding array of choices that extend far beyond the classic white and gray veining we’ve come to expect. Each type tells its own geological story, painted in swirls of gold, rose, emerald, and onyx, creating unique canvases that transform ordinary rooms into timeless masterpieces of natural artistry.
